时间:2024-12-10 来源:网络 人气:
在安卓系统中,UID(User ID)是一个非常重要的概念,它用于唯一标识一个应用程序。UID授权机制则是确保应用程序在访问系统资源或用户数据时,能够得到适当的权限。本文将深入解析安卓系统UID授权机制,帮助开发者更好地理解和应用这一机制。
UID在安卓系统中用于标识一个应用程序,每个应用程序在安装时都会被分配一个唯一的UID。UID的作用主要体现在以下几个方面:
确保应用程序的独立性:每个应用程序都有自己的UID,这意味着它们在系统中的运行是相互隔离的,一个应用程序的崩溃或异常不会影响到其他应用程序。
保护用户隐私和数据安全:UID授权机制可以限制应用程序访问系统资源或用户数据,从而保护用户的隐私和数据安全。
提高系统稳定性:通过UID授权机制,系统可以更好地管理应用程序的运行,提高系统的稳定性。
在安卓系统中,UID的分配是由系统自动完成的。以下是如何查看应用程序UID的几种方式:
1. 通过AndroidManifest.xml文件
在应用程序的AndroidManifest.xml文件中,可以通过以下代码查看应用程序的UID:
<manifest xmlns:android=